--- testPVStructureArrayGold 2012-01-21 13:09:45.250002792 -0500 +++ testPVStructureArray 2012-07-19 16:06:14.944022783 -0400 @@ -1,7 +1,27 @@ +pvAlarmStructure +structure[] + structure + int severity 0 + int status 0 + string message + structure + int severity 0 + int status 0 + string message +copy +structure[] + structure + int severity 0 + int status 0 + string message + structure + int severity 0 + int status 0 + string message after append 5 -structure powerSupply +structure structure[] value -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-20,7 +40,7 @@ int severity 0 int status 0 string message -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-39,7 +59,75 @@ int severity 0 int status 0 string message - structure powerSupply + structure + structure voltage +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ure power +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ure current +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ure + structure voltage +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ure power +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ure current +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ure + structure voltage +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ure power +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ure current + double value 0 + structure alarm + int severity 0 + int status 0 + string message + structure alarm + int severity 0 + int status 0 + string message + structure timeStamp + long secondsPastEpoch 0 + int nanoSeconds 0 + int userTag 0 +after remove(0,2) +structure + structure[] value + structure structure voltage double value 0 structure alarm @@ -58,7 +146,7 @@ int severity 0 int status 0 string message -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-77,7 +165,7 @@ int severity 0 int status 0 string message -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-96,19 +184,17 @@ int severity 0 int status 0 string message - alarm alarm + structure alarm int severity 0 int status 0 string message - timeStamp timeStamp + structure timeStamp long secondsPastEpoch 0 int nanoSeconds 0 int userTag 0 -after remove 0,1,3structure powerSupply +after remove 2,1structure structure[] value - null - null -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-127,8 +213,7 @@ int severity 0 int status 0 string message - null -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-147,17 +232,17 @@ int severity 0 int status 0 string message - alarm alarm + structure alarm int severity 0 int status 0 string message - timeStamp timeStamp + structure timeStamp long secondsPastEpoch 0 int nanoSeconds 0 int userTag 0 -after compressstructure powerSupply +after compressstructure structure[] value -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-176,7 +261,7 @@ int severity 0 int status 0 string message - structure powerSupply + structure structure voltage double value 0 structure alarm @@ -195,13 +280,11 @@ int severity 0 int status 0 string message - alarm alarm + structure alarm int severity 0 int status 0 string message - timeStamp timeStamp + structure timeStamp long secondsPastEpoch 0 int nanoSeconds 0 int userTag 0 -pvField: totalConstruct 105 totalDestruct 105 -field: totalConstruct 104 totalDestruct 104